3140166151 is a prime number
BaseRepresentation
bin1011101100101011…
…0010001000000111
322002211202222011001
42323022302020013
522412340304101
61235332354131
7140546654233
oct27312621007
98084688131
103140166151
1113715a6341
12737775947
133b074c3a5
1421b0915c3
15135a2e901
hexbb2b2207

3140166151 has 2 divisors, whose sum is σ = 3140166152. Its totient is φ = 3140166150.

The previous prime is 3140166143. The next prime is 3140166187. The reversal of 3140166151 is 1516610413.

It is a weak prime.

It is a cyclic number.

It is not a de Polignac number, because 3140166151 - 23 = 3140166143 is a prime.

It is a congruent number.

It is not a weakly prime, because it can be changed into another prime (3140166121) by changing a digit.

It is a polite number, since it can be written as a sum of consecutive naturals, namely, 1570083075 + 1570083076.

It is an arithmetic number, because the mean of its divisors is an integer number (1570083076).

Almost surely, 23140166151 is an apocalyptic number.

3140166151 is a deficient number, since it is larger than the sum of its proper divisors (1).

3140166151 is an equidigital number, since it uses as much as digits as its factorization.

3140166151 is an odious number, because the sum of its binary digits is odd.

The product of its (nonzero) digits is 2160, while the sum is 28.

The square root of 3140166151 is about 56037.1854307477. The cubic root of 3140166151 is about 1464.3701783149.

Adding to 3140166151 its reverse (1516610413), we get a palindrome (4656776564).

The spelling of 3140166151 in words is "three billion, one hundred forty million, one hundred sixty-six thousand, one hundred fifty-one".